Ford keen to develop Wings youth set-up

Welling boss Andy Ford has turned his attention to the club's youth set-up during pre-season.

The Wings manager has placed first-team coach Keith Lovett in charge of their FA Youth Cup preliminary round tie against Wealdstone in September.

The aim is to merge the cream of the talent at their disposal, from their PASE scheme run at Lewisham College and from the youth teams of Welling and Corinthian last season.

Many of the team that plays in the FA Youth Cup are also expected to be involved in the club's new reserve team which will play in Division 2 of the Kent League this season.

Ford said: "It's something that the club hasn't got and it needs to be in place.

"It might not start to show until Christmas time but it could prove to be a tremedous back-up to have those players coming through.

"They could catch everyone by surprise and it's something that we have been working on."
